LEEDS, England (Reuters) - England forgot the basics of a run chase, captain Eoin Morgan said after his team's shock defeat by Sri Lanka in a low-scoring World Cup thriller on Friday.

Three days after posting the tournament's highest score of 397-6 against Afghanistan, Morgan's men imploded chasing 233 for victory against another Asian side in a major upset that breathed fresh life into the tournament.
